Took a break from my turn signal fiasco and I'm dealing with headlight wiring now. I noticed in the DC catalog they list 6v headlight switches for the '54s. Do I need to swap to a 12v H/L switch for my 12v conversion?
Some will say yes, but I ran 12v through an original 6v switch in a '53 I had. Sold the car recently after about 25 years still with the original switch and it's still working. My '55 Merc still has its 6v switch; the lights work fine but the rheostat for the dash lights gave up the ghost.

I am running the stock headlight switch in my 55, the contacts in the 6V switch are larger so they work just fine. The only issue is the dimming feature for the dash lights does not dim the dash lights much at all but I usually leave the dash lights on high anyway. I think you are fine.
